Letter from Edmond J. Frewen, 8 Waterloo Place, Pall Mall, London, to John Redmond, insisting that the Irish Volunteers are being undermined, and that "Orange interests" in the War Office are hindering any effort to make the Volunteers an effective military force,
1914 Dec. 3.
